CAN TV Board of Directors Adds Four New Members
January 6, 2022
Chicago, IL, January 6, 2022 /Newswire/ — Chicago Access Network Television (CAN TV) Board of Directors elected four new members to the board at its December 8, 2021 annual meeting. Tribute to Community Producer Bill Wildt – Saturday Jan. 8th on CAN TV19
January 4, 2022
Bill Wildt, host and producer of Motorsports Unlimited passed away in December 2021. Motivated by his love of all things with an engine, he created 1,427 episodes for the weekly series that ran on CAN TV19 for 34 years.
